Interview: Ron Jenkins and Avery Mills of CINDERELLA at Lionheart Productions
by Brian Hilbrand - Oct 30, 2022


Rodgers + Hammerstein's Cinderella opens at the Grant Fine Arts Center this week, bringing back Lion Heart Productions’ first large-cast musical since Mamma Mia! In 2019.  The show is running 2 weekends, through November 12th, and is the new Broadway adaptation of the classic musical. This contemporary take on the classic tale features Rodgers & Hammerstein's most beloved songs, including “In My Own Little Corner,” “Impossible/It's Possible” and “Ten Minutes Ago”.   BroadwayWorld Michigan had a chance to speak with Director Ron Jenkins and one of the show's stars, Avery Mills playing Ella, in this classic and delightful show. National Youth Theater to Present NARNIA, THE MUSICAL in November
by Chloe Rabinowitz - Oct 7, 2022


National Youth Theater will present Narnia, The Musical, November 18-20. Narnia, The Musical is a dramatization of The Lion, the Witch and the Wardrobe, the first and most famous of acclaimed British author C.S. Lewis's world-renowned series, The Chronicles of Narnia.

Cast Announced Joining Samantha Womack in THE LION, THE WITCH, AND THE WARDROBE
by Stephi Wild - Jun 20, 2022


Casting was announced today (20 June 2022) for the smash-hit production of C.S. Lewis' classic The Lion, the Witch and the Wardrobe, which will make its West End premiere this summer at the Gillian Lynne Theatre, Drury Lane, London.  The show, which begins rehearsals today, is produced by the same team that recently won 5 Tony Awards for its production of Company on Broadway.
